In a devastating turn of events, two teenage girls lost their lives after being rescued from the water at Coney Island Beach in New York City. The incident occurred on Friday evening when authorities received distress calls about three individuals struggling in the water off Coney Island in Brooklyn.
A frantic search operation was initiated by the New York City Fire Department (FDNY) to locate the teenagers. After more than an hour of intensive searching, the rescue team successfully retrieved the two girls, identified as an 18-year-old and a 17-year-old, from the water.
Both teenagers were immediately rushed to Coney Island Hospital in critical condition. However, overnight updates from law enforcement sources confirmed that the two sisters had tragically succumbed to their injuries at the hospital. At this time, their identities have not been released.
Initially, divers were also searching for a missing man in his 20s who was believed to be in the water. However, police later clarified that there was no third missing swimmer.
This incident follows a similar tragedy last month at Jacob Riis Park, another popular beach in New York City, where two teenage boys drowned. Concerns have been raised about the recent spate of drownings caused by rip currents at beaches.
Rip currents have proven to be a deadly phenomenon, claiming lives in various locations. In Florida, a Pennsylvania couple lost their lives along with their six children after being caught in a rip current while swimming at Stuart Beach. Additionally, three men from Alabama drowned last month after becoming trapped in a rip current at Panama City Beach in Florida.
Experts advise that when caught in a rip current, it is crucial to remain calm, signal for help, and swim parallel to the shore until one is out of the dangerous current.
